Bradesco Foundation Offers Over 50 Free Online Courses With Flexible Access and Digital Certificate, Check How to Participate!
The Bradesco Foundation continues to be a reference in digital inclusion and professional training by offering over 50 free online courses through the Bradesco Virtual School platform. The training is aimed at students, professionals, entrepreneurs, and anyone interested in developing personal and professional skills.
With no educational requirements and access available at any time of day, the courses are offered in areas such as technology, communication, business, education, and finance. All are free, self-paced, and provide a digital certificate at the end of the course.
Bradesco Foundation’s Free Courses Are Accessible to Everyone
The Bradesco Virtual School platform (www.ev.org.br) is one of the most democratic distance learning initiatives in the country. The free online training requires no prior experience and is available to anyone with internet access, only requiring a free registration on the site.

The Foundation’s aim is to broaden access to knowledge and contribute to training professionals better prepared for the job market. The flexible learning system allows students to progress through content according to their schedules, without pressure from fixed time slots.
How Enrollment Works for the Virtual School Courses
To enroll, interested individuals must access the official site of the platform (www.ev.org.br), fill out a form with basic personal information (name, email, and CPF), and choose the desired course. The content is released immediately after registration.
The student has up to 60 days to complete the course from the date of enrollment. If the deadline expires, they can re-enroll without any fees. Upon completing the training with satisfactory results, the student can generate and print a free digital certificate, valid for enhancing their resume and verifying extracurricular hours at educational institutions and selection processes.
Available Areas and Main Free Courses
The courses offered by the Bradesco Foundation cover a wide range of topics, allowing for both professional development and the acquisition of new personal skills. Among the most sought-after courses are:
Personal and Professional Development
- Business Communication
- Professional Attitude and Image
- Quality of Life and Work
- Writing Techniques
- Financial Education
- Financial Mathematics with HP 12C
Information Technology
- IT Fundamentals: Hardware and Software
- Information Technology Security
- Introduction to Computer Networks
- Data Modeling
- Database Administration
- Digital Culture
Programming
- HTML and CSS in Practice
- Development with Android Studio
- Basic Python
- Java Language (Basic and Advanced)
- JavaScript and Programming Logic
- IT System Projects
Business and Innovation
- Entrepreneurship and Innovation
- Introduction to Management
- Project Management
- General Data Protection Law (LGPD)
- Artificial Intelligence and Digital Culture
Education and Active Methodologies
- Inclusive Education
- Active Methodologies in Practice
- Design Thinking for Educators
- Portuguese Language Workshop (Grammar)
- Preparation for ENEM and Entrance Exams
There are also specific courses on Microsoft tools, such as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and Office 365, at basic, intermediate, and advanced levels.
Who Can Take Bradesco Foundation Courses?
The free courses from the Bradesco Foundation are open to any Brazilian citizen interested in learning, regardless of age, education, or professional situation. There are no formal prerequisites for most courses, making the program highly inclusive.
High school students, university students, professionals seeking to re-enter the job market, or entrepreneurs looking for new tools for their businesses find in the Bradesco Virtual School an excellent source of training.
Free Certificate from Bradesco Foundation Helps with Resumes and Competitions
Upon completing the course with satisfactory performance, the participant can issue a free digital certificate, which can be saved as a PDF and printed. This certificate is accepted in many selection processes as a curriculum supplement, as well as serving as proof of hours in internship programs, complementary activities at colleges, and even public competitions.
The document also demonstrates the candidate’s proactivity and dedication, qualities valued by recruiters at the time of hiring.
Platform Promotes Free Education Since 2001
The Bradesco Foundation Virtual School was created in 2001 and has already surpassed 15 million enrollments. Its differential is precisely unrestricted access to updated content, with clear language, intuitive navigation, and free technical support.
The institution reaffirms its commitment to free and quality education, contributing to the formation of a more informed and capable society. Each year, new courses are added according to market trends and the demands of digital transformation.
